1 #ifndef RecoVertex_PixelVertexFinding_plugins_alpaka_vertexFinder_h 2 #define RecoVertex_PixelVertexFinding_plugins_alpaka_vertexFinder_h 7 #include <alpaka/alpaka.hpp> 33 template <
typename TrackerTraits>
78 #endif // RecoVertex_PixelVertexFinding_plugins_alpaka_vertexFinder_h
std::conditional_t< std::is_same_v< Device, alpaka::DevCpu >, ZVertexHost, ZVertexDevice< Device > > ZVertexSoACollection
uint32_t const *__restrict__ TkSoAView< TrackerTraits > tracks_view
Producer(bool oneKernel, bool useDensity, bool useDBSCAN, bool useIterative, bool doSplitting, int iminT, float ieps, float ierrmax, float ichi2max)
::reco::ZVertexTracksSoAView TrkSoAView
ALPAKA_FN_ACC void operator()(Acc1D const &acc, VtxSoAView data, WsSoAView ws) const
ZVertexSoAHeterogeneousLayout<>::View ZVertexSoAView
ZVertexTracksSoA::View ZVertexTracksSoAView
reco::TrackSoAConstView< TrackerTraits > TkSoAConstView
PixelVertexWSSoALayout<>::View PixelVertexWorkSpaceSoAView
::vertexFinder::PixelVertexWorkSpaceSoAView WsSoAView
typename reco::TrackSoA< TrackerTraits >::template Layout<>::ConstView TrackSoAConstView
::reco::ZVertexSoAView VtxSoAView